The term "artificial gravity" refers to using science technology to create gravity. This is usually desired by astronauts and space organizations such as NASA to keep their astronauts healthy and to minimize the effects of weightlessness on astronauts during long term space travel.
The time when the moon is more than half lighted but not quite full is referred to as a gibbous moon. The word 'gibbous' came from a word that originally meant 'hump-backed'.

It is called Strabismus, commonly known as a Squint
The term "Chinese squint" is a stereotype that is not accurate. The misconception may be due to the epicanthic fold seen in some East Asian populations, which can give the appearance of narrower eyes. However, it does not affect vision or cause people to intentionally squint.
